TRANSACTION HASH
0xda779793d00cc271ff26167ca76f39adbd4b061b823f7205d84d0541c21efe6a
TX COST
$0.02 / 0.033169 eth
GAS USED / GAS LIMIT
872876 / 2971312
GAS PRICE (BASE FEE + PRIORITY FEE)
38000000000 (35586970814 + 2413029186) wei
DATE
Sun Mar 19 2023 07:47:17 GMT+0000
TRANSACTION INDEX
1
Token Transfers
From
To
Token
Amount
Value
Balances
Address
Token
Amount
Value
Total
Address: spLP(WFTM, BOO)
Token: WFTM
Amount: 248.5823
Value: $114.40
Total: -$1.27
Token: BOO
Amount: -63.9015
Value: -$115.66
Transaction Trace
- [711100]FireBirdRouter.swap(caller =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, desc = (USD Coin, SpookyToken, 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, 120753943, 63262513516029539055, 4, 0x), data = 0x0000000000000000000000000000000000000000000000000000000000000020000000000000000000000000000000000000000000000000000000000000012000000000000000000000000004068da6c83afcfa0e13ba15a6696662335d5b75000000000000000000000000841fad6eae12c286d1fd18d1d525dffa75c7effe0000000000000000000000000000000000000000000000036df198dd1949f2ef0000000000000000000000000000000000000000000000000000000000000004ff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ff000000000000000000000000913d97dae24a2564b0b092fe99e0df5291a6c086000000000000000000000000000000000000000000000000000000006416c2aa00000000000000000000000000000000000000000000000000000000000003c00000000000000000000000000000000000000000000000000000000000000001000000000000000000000000000000000000000000000000000000000000002000000000000000000000000000000000000000000000000000000000000000020000000000000000000000000000000000000000000000000000000000000040000000000000000000000000000000000000000000000000000000000000014000000000000000000000000000000000000000000000000000000000000000400000000000000000000000000000000000000000000000000000000000000f0000000000000000000000000000000000000000000000000000000000000000a000000000000000000000000058e3018b9991abb9075776537f192669d69ca93000000000000000000000000004068da6c83afcfa0e13ba15a6696662335d5b7500000000000000000000000021be370d5312f44cb42ce377bc9b8a0cef1a4c83000000000000000000000000000000000000000000000000000000000731a33f00000000000000000000000000000000000000000000000000000000000000010000000000000000000000000000000000000000000000000000000000000040000000000000000000000000000000000000000000000000000000000000000300000000000000000000000000000000000000000000000000000000000000a0000000000000000000000000ec7178f4c41f346b2721907f5cf7628e388a7a5800000000000000000000000021be370d5312f44cb42ce377bc9b8a0cef1a4c83000000000000000000000000841fad6eae12c286d1fd18d1d525dffa75c7effe00000000000000000000000000000000000000000000000d79c5cbf614fd7a00000000000000000000000000000000000000000000000000000000000000000100000000000000000000000000000000000000000000000000000000000000157b22736f75726365223a226669726562697264227d0000000000000000000000)
- [32489]USD Coin.transferFrom(from =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, value = 120753943)
- emit USD Coin.Transfer(from =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, value = 120753943)
- return(True)
- return(0)
- [655215]0x5BAB9d61f84630A76fA9e2f67739f2da694B5402.#5697e453(000000000000000000000000000000000000000000000000000000000000040000000000000000000000000913d97dae24a2564b0b092fe99e0df5291a6c08600000000000000000000000000000000000000000000000000000000000004200000000000000000000000000000000000000000000000000000000000000020000000000000000000000000000000000000000000000000000000000000012000000000000000000000000004068da6c83afcfa0e13ba15a6696662335d5b75000000000000000000000000841fad6eae12c286d1fd18d1d525dffa75c7effe0000000000000000000000000000000000000000000000036df198dd1949f2ef0000000000000000000000000000000000000000000000000000000000000004ff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ffffff000000000000000000000000913d97dae24a2564b0b092fe99e0df5291a6c086000000000000000000000000000000000000000000000000000000006416c2aa00000000000000000000000000000000000000000000000000000000000003c00000000000000000000000000000000000000000000000000000000000000001000000000000000000000000000000000000000000000000000000000000002000000000000000000000000000000000000000000000000000000000000000020000000000000000000000000000000000000000000000000000000000000040000000000000000000000000000000000000000000000000000000000000014000000000000000000000000000000000000000000000000000000000000000400000000000000000000000000000000000000000000000000000000000000f0000000000000000000000000000000000000000000000000000000000000000a000000000000000000000000058e3018b9991abb9075776537f192669d69ca93000000000000000000000000004068da6c83afcfa0e13ba15a6696662335d5b7500000000000000000000000021be370d5312f44cb42ce377bc9b8a0cef1a4c83000000000000000000000000000000000000000000000000000000000731a33f00000000000000000000000000000000000000000000000000000000000000010000000000000000000000000000000000000000000000000000000000000040000000000000000000000000000000000000000000000000000000000000000300000000000000000000000000000000000000000000000000000000000000a0000000000000000000000000ec7178f4c41f346b2721907f5cf7628e388a7a5800000000000000000000000021be370d5312f44cb42ce377bc9b8a0cef1a4c83000000000000000000000000841fad6eae12c286d1fd18d1d525dffa75c7effe00000000000000000000000000000000000000000000000d79c5cbf614fd7a00000000000000000000000000000000000000000000000000000000000000000100000000000000000000000000000000000000000000000000000000000000157b22736f75726365223a226669726562697264227d000000000000000000000)
- return(0)
- return(120753943)
- emit USD Coin.Transfer(from =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, to = UpgradableProxy, value = 60376)
- return(True)
- emit 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402Event(0x4c1783225ee672b8707eb1a34d79d06e1c62ee35ba8db16bc351e35179b3b5d1, memory = 000000000000000000000000000000000000000000000000000000000000ebd800000000000000000000000004068da6c83afcfa0e13ba15a6696662335d5b75000000000000000000000000913d97dae24a2564b0b092fe99e0df5291a6c086000000000000000000000000000000000000000000000000000000006416be0500000000000000000000000000000000000000000000000000000000000000a000000000000000000000000000000000000000000000000000000000000000157b22736f75726365223a226669726562697264227d0000000000000000000000)
- return(0)
- return(120693567)
- emit USD Coin.Transfer(from =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, to = Vault, value = 120693567)
- return(True)
- [304397]Vault.swap(_tokenIn = USD Coin, _tokenOut = Wrapped Fantom, _receiver =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402)
- return(True)
- return(True)
- return(484850651589)
- return(2930)
- return(18446744073709554546)
- return(99986101)
- return(99986101)
- [9997]FastPriceFeed.getPrice(_token = USD Coin, _refPrice = 999861010000000000000000000000, _maximise = False)
- return(999861010000000000000000000000)
- return(1000000000000000000000000000000)
- [52550]VaultPriceFeed.getPrice(_token = Wrapped Fantom, _maximise = True, _includeAmmPrice = True, True)
- return(340459)
- return(18446744073709892075)
- return(48507267)
- return(48507267)
- [18157]FastPriceFeed.getPrice(_token = Wrapped Fantom, _refPrice = 485072670000000000000000000000, _maximise = True)
- return(484800000000000000000000000000)
- return(485284800000000000000000000000)
- [50870]VaultUtils.getSwapFeeBasisPoints(_tokenIn = USD Coin, _tokenOut = Wrapped Fantom, _usdgAmount = 120693567000000000000)
- return(True)
- return(False)
- return(5)
- return(25)
- return(True)
- return(471233596855251938809492)
- return(1226238114186623208569427)
- return(613119057093311604284713)
- return(True)
- return(239600300084036036815277)
- return(1226238114186623208569427)
- return(245247622837324641713885)
- return(5)
- [13635]VaultPriceFeed.getPrice(_token = Wrapped Fantom, _maximise = False, _includeAmmPrice = True, True)
- return(340459)
- return(18446744073709892075)
- return(48507267)
- return(48507267)
- [4157]FastPriceFeed.getPrice(_token = Wrapped Fantom, _refPrice = 485072670000000000000000000000, _maximise = False)
- return(484800000000000000000000000000)
- return(484315200000000000000000000000)
- emit Vault.CollectSwapFees(token = Wrapped Fantom, feeUsd = 60226210311192000000000000000, feeTokens = 124353335000000000)
- emit Vault.IncreaseUsdgAmount(token = USD Coin, amount = 120693567000000000000)
- emit Vault.DecreaseUsdgAmount(token = Wrapped Fantom, amount = 120693567000000000000)
- return(484850651589)
- emit Vault.IncreasePoolAmount(token = USD Coin, amount = 120693567)
- emit Vault.DecreasePoolAmount(token = Wrapped Fantom, amount = 248706670000000000000)
- [30098]Wrapped Fantom.transfer(to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, value = 248582316665000000000)
- emit Wrapped Fantom.Transfer(from = Vault, to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, value = 248582316665000000000)
- return(True)
- return(381427582947017151807179)
- emit Vault.Swap(account =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, tokenIn = USD Coin, tokenOut = Wrapped Fantom, amountIn = 120693567, amountOut = 248706670000000000000, amountOutAfterFees = 248582316665000000000, feeBasisPoints = 5)
- return(248582316665000000000)
- return(248582316665000000000)
- emit 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402.Exchange(pair = Vault, amountOut = 248582316665000000000, output = Wrapped Fantom)
- emit Wrapped Fantom.Transfer(from =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, to = spLP(WFTM, BOO), value = 248582316665000000000)
- return(True)
- [16073]FireBirdFormula.getFactoryReserveAndWeights(factory = 0xc7A50FE12C864963Ea5A5E0858a0E7Abe5b875c4, pair = spLP(WFTM, BOO), tokenA = Wrapped Fantom, dexId = 3)
- return(_reserve0 = 8739878966664596976995672, _reserve1 = 2251273306681392966873807, _blockTimestampLast = 1679211915)
- return(Wrapped Fantom)
- return(SpookyToken)
- return(tokenB = SpookyToken, reserveA = 8739878966664596976995672, reserveB = 2251273306681392966873807, tokenWeightA = 50, tokenWeightB = 50, swapFee = 20)
- return(8740127548981261976995672)
- [1070]FireBirdFormula.getAmountOut(amountIn = 248582316665000000000, reserveIn = 8739878966664596976995672, reserveOut = 2251273306681392966873807, tokenWeightIn = 50, tokenWeightOut = 50, swapFee = 20)
- return(amountOut = 63901528804070241469)
- return(0)
- return(Wrapped Fantom)
- [170137]spLP(WFTM, BOO).swap(amount0Out = 0, amount1Out = 63901528804070241469, to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, data = 0x)
- [141732]SpookyToken.transfer(recipient =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, amount = 63901528804070241469)
- emit SpookyToken.Transfer(from = spLP(WFTM, BOO), to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, value = 63901528804070241469)
- emit SpookyToken.DelegateVotesChanged(delegate = spLP(WFTM, BOO), previousBalance = 2251273306681392966873807, newBalance = 2251209405152588896632338)
- emit SpookyToken.DelegateVotesChanged(delegate =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, previousBalance = 0, newBalance = 63901528804070241469)
- return(True)
- return(8740127548981261976995672)
- return(2251209405152588896632338)
- emit spLP(WFTM, BOO).Sync(reserve0 = 8740127548981261976995672, reserve1 = 2251209405152588896632338)
- emit spLP(WFTM, BOO).Swap(sender =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, to =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, amount0In = 248582316665000000000, amount1In = 0, amount0Out = 0, amount1Out = 63901528804070241469)
- return(63901528804070241469)
- emit 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402.Exchange(pair = spLP(WFTM, BOO), amountOut = 63901528804070241469, output = SpookyToken)
- emit 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402Event(0xbe5d8d003f6a9440355144a23deb704a6b4b4d3bd2de45b01b78dc077822adc0, memory = 000000000000000000000000841fad6eae12c286d1fd18d1d525dffa75c7effe00000000000000000000000000000000000000000000000376cfd5e1eaffb4bd000000000000000000000000913d97dae24a2564b0b092fe99e0df5291a6c086000000000000000000000000000000000000000000000000000000006416be0500000000000000000000000000000000000000000000000000000000000000a000000000000000000000000000000000000000000000000000000000000000157b22736f75726365223a226669726562697264227d0000000000000000000000)
- [83624]SpookyToken.transfer(recipient =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, amount = 63901528804070241469)
- emit SpookyToken.Transfer(from =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, to =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, value = 63901528804070241469)
- emit SpookyToken.DelegateVotesChanged(delegate =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, previousBalance = 63901528804070241469, newBalance = 0)
- emit SpookyToken.DelegateVotesChanged(delegate =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, previousBalance = 0, newBalance = 63901528804070241469)
- return(True)
- return(0)
- return(63901528804070241469)
- return(63901528804070241469)
- emit FireBirdRouter.Swapped(sender =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, srcToken = USD Coin, dstToken = SpookyToken, dstReceiver = 0x913D97DAe24A2564B0b092fE99e0df5291a6C086, spentAmount = 120753943, returnAmount = 63901528804070241469)
- emit FireBirdRouter.Exchange(pair = 0x5BAB9d61f84630A76fA9e2f67739f2da694B5402, amountOut = 63901528804070241469, output = SpookyToken)
- return(returnAmount = 63901528804070241469, gasLeft = 2228618)